TEVA 7012 Pill - white round

Pill with imprint TEVA 7012 is White, Round and has been identified as Deferasirox (for Oral Suspension) 250 mg. It is supplied by Teva Pharmaceuticals USA, Inc.

Deferasirox is used in the treatment of Iron Overload; Thalassemia; Hemosiderosis and belongs to the drug class chelating agents.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y. Deferasirox 250 mg is not a controlled substance under the Controlled Substances Act (CSA).
